Curating the First Ever Bondi PopUp gallery at Bondi the Beautiful Fair was a buzz!! The theme was BILLOW: everything & anything to do with the sea, wind, sky & the Fair was about recycling & conservation which our works fit right into. This image is an on-the-spot billow.
Contributing artists were Linden Braye, Betty Smith, Gail Carson, Mark Elliot, Jo Mulcahy-Zubani, Sue Saxon and Yvette Sarasola—a mix of Waverley artists in residence, Inner West and Western Sydney with about 16 works in our Pop Tent.

One of the best things about sitting a gallery show is the people.
A man told me not to take anything personally as he ushered his unsighted mother around the walls. To him they were silly. He came out with the classic, "A 7-year old could..." and repeatedly dismissed them with "Strings. Lots of strings." "More strings."
Until he came to one, in fluoro pinks, ribbons & roses. I braced myself, then he stepped back as he told her, "Now, [big pause] this one! This one's [got me]."
So you never know. (see above)
